Output 63dffd171a7118de0bc588cf437b8ea29cb51e7f8df6a30db1bcded7ef9879ae:1

value
1098320
script pubkey
OP_0 OP_PUSHBYTES_20 938ffe63ae406d640996194f6302842bd23a30f4
address
ltc1qjw8lucawgpkkgzvkr98kxq5y90fr5v85uhqp5r
transaction
63dffd171a7118de0bc588cf437b8ea29cb51e7f8df6a30db1bcded7ef9879ae
spent
true